Created as a collaboration between Pollock's Toy Museum and the Museum of Witchcraft and Magic in Boscastle, Cornwall, this toy theatre kit draws on imagery from British magical practice to provide a range of characters and scenes for your own storytelling.
Artist and designer Jack Fawdry Tatham explored the MWM collection and Cornish folk tales to gather inspiration for this work. His original etching with aquatint was then reproduced on a litho printing press to create this theatre.
The toy theatre kit arrives flat-packed and requires cutting, gluing, and a little patience during construction. You will need fast-drying glue and scissors, or a craft knife, to complete your model.
Black and white, for you to colour yourself, or display in stylish monochrome.
Designed and printed in the UK on premium Italian paper.
